Why would you expect a C-C sigma bond formed by sp2-sp2 overlap to be stronger than a sigma bond formed by sp3-sp3 overlap?

A C-C sigma bond formed by sp2-sp2 overlap is stronger than one formed by sp3-sp3 overlap because the sp2 hybrid orbitals have a greater s-character (33%) compared to sp3 orbitals (25%), leading to more effective overlap and stronger bonding. This higher s-character causes the sp2-sp2 bond to be shorter and stronger than the sp3-sp3 bond.

What is the hybridization of the nitrogen atom of pyridine?

The nitrogen atom of pyridine is sp2 hybridized. It participates in the aromatic ring system of pyridine and forms three sigma bonds with neighboring carbon atoms, resulting in the sp2 hybridization.
